Aluminum trim offers a versatile and aesthetically appealing solution for enhancing the exterior appearance of residential properties. Its diverse range of designs can significantly elevate the visual appeal of a home by adding character, sophistication, and a modern touch. The selection of shapes, such as channels, angles, and decorative trims, allows homeowners and builders to create cohesive and visually striking exterior architectural accents. These designs can subtly complement existing siding and window styles, ensuring harmony in the overall facade. Moreover, aluminum trim's durability, resistance to corrosion, and ease of maintenance make it an ideal choice for outdoor applications, providing long-lasting beauty and functionality.
Manufactured through extrusion processes, aluminum trims like T-shaped profiles are integral to architecture and millwork. They serve multiple purposes, including framing retail fixtures, creating visual displays, and shaping furniture components. Their use extends to edging tiles, preventing chipping and providing smooth transitions between different flooring surfaces. In renovation projects, aluminum trims facilitate retrofitting by offering contemporary options that update old structures with modern aesthetics. The material's lightweight nature combined with high strength ensures that it withstands various environmental conditions without compromising structural integrity, making it highly suitable for residential or commercial exterior embellishments.
One prominent design feature is aluminum channels, which are appreciated for their aesthetic appeal and functional versatility. These channels come in various forms, including H-shaped and round profiles, suited for many construction applications. They are widely employed for mounting fixtures, protecting edges, housing LED lighting, and creating architectural accents. Aluminum channels are highly customizable, as they can be cut to any required length, offering flexibility to fit specific project dimensions. Their corrosion resistance, affordability, and ease of installation make them a preferred choice for exterior trim and structural detailing in homes and commercial buildings alike.
The Angle L profile is another popular aluminum trim design characterized by its simple L-shaped geometry, comprising two equal-length legs forming a 90-degree angle. This design combines lightweight construction with strength, suitable for both industrial and residential uses. It is available in numerous colors and finishes, allowing for personalization and aesthetic matching with existing exterior design elements. Its versatility makes it ideal for framing, edge protection, or decorative purposes in various architectural applications, including window surrounds and door frames.
Aluminum hat channels are distinctive for their decorative yet functional role in building exteriors. They act as divider strips between wall panels, sheetrock, or tiles, offering a stylish alternative to traditional wood or steel solutions. Their structural properties provide durability, water resistance, and thermal efficiency, which are crucial for exterior applications. Used extensively in masonry walls, ceilings, siding, and curtain walls, hat channels facilitate quick and easy installation, reducing construction time and labor costs. Their design also ensures fire-resistant and water-resistant features, critical for outdoor and exposed environments.
Another elegant option is the round aluminum channel, which combines aesthetic finesse with structural strength. Its sharp right angles and smooth or fluted profiles lend themselves well to architectural detailing and millwork applications. Round channels can function both as edging to prevent tile chipping and as transitions between different floor levels or materials. They are also frequently utilized as housing for LED lighting strips, adding functional illumination elements to exterior facades. Available in various finishes—such as mill finish, clear anodized, bronze, black, and gold anodized—these channels offer customization to match diverse architectural themes and color schemes.
